首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> Web前端 >

log4j 日记初始化

2012-09-29 
log4j 日志初始化Logger log Logger.getRootLogger()//输入形式设置PatternLayout layout new Patter

log4j 日志初始化

Logger log = Logger.getRootLogger();
//输入形式设置
    PatternLayout layout = new PatternLayout();
    layout.setConversionPattern("[%t][%d{yyyy-MM-dd HH:mm:ss}]%5p - %m%n");
    //日志输出位置初始化
    String fileName = "logs"+File.separator+"main.log";
    RollingFileAppender appd = new RollingFileAppender(layout,fileName);
    appd.setEncoding("GBK");
    appd.setMaxFileSize("10MB");
    appd.setName("mainlogapdr");
    appd.setMaxBackupIndex(10);
    log.addAppender(appd);
    //设置日志级别
    if("DEBUG".equals(getLevel()))
    {
    log.setLevel(Level.DEBUG);
    }
    else if("INFO".equals(getLevel()))
    {
    log.setLevel(Level.INFO);
    }
    else if("WARN".equals(getLevel()))
    {
    log.setLevel(Level.WARN);
    }
    else if("ERROR".equals(getLevel()))
    {
    log.setLevel(Level.ERROR);
    }

热点排行